Superb performances of Romantic gems. 8 Sep 2000
By D. R. Schryer - Published on Amazon.com
Format:Audio CD
I have always loved the 2nd Wieniawski Violin concerto but I did not particularly like the 1st concerto until I heard it played by Gil Shaham in this recording. Now I love both of these concertos. Gil Shaham's performance of the 1st concerto is staggering in virtuosity and intensity but also artistically compelling and tonally gorgeous. I have never heard a performance of the Wieniawski 1st which even approaches this one. Shaham's performances of the more-lyrical 2nd concerto -- and the Legende and Ziegeunerweissen -- are also beautifully played. If you like violin music, please treat yourself to this CD.

Shaham tops the charts in Wieniawski interpretations 24 Sep 2003
By "jkillashark" - Published on Amazon.com
Format:Audio CD
I have listened to the first concerto by Henryk Wieniawski and found it to be somewhat boring and sluggish. This I found out was not because of the music, but because of the player. After I listened to Shaham, I found it extremely exciting from the grandioso tenths to the three-string chords and to the ending. I find that he is the only violinist worth listening to play the first concerto. His second concerto is absolutely superb. Perlman's recording is fantastic but I found much more heart put into the Romance by Shaham. The Allegro con fuoco put fire into my heart when I listened to it. I find that Shaham's playing is so much more cleaner than Perlman and Heifetz and still maintains the fiery speed. The harmonics are just so slick and timed just right. The CD also includes Wieniawski's love song that got him married, Legende, and the ever-so-popular Sarasate piece, Zigeunerweisen. I find that Shaham interprets the Wieniawski concertos the best. Now if only Vengerov can record them...
